How to track the usage of reports and dashboard without date range limitation

Hi. May I know if anyone can advise is there a way to track the usage of reports and dashboard without date range limitation?

At present, I have two ideas, but neither can fully meet our needs:
1) Use the Report Usage Metric Report delivered with Power BI
The old version of the report had 90 days of data, but fewer metrics;
The new version has rich report metrics. In addition to the metrics related to report usage, there are also report performance metrics, but only 30 days of data.
2) Download Audit Log
This approach seems to allow you to customize the date range of the data, but there is no report page level data, and a report is usually multi-pages.


To summarize the current needs:
1) Do not limit the date range of data.
2) As many fields as possible (similar to the new Report Usage Metric Report), including report usage and report performance.
3) Report/Dashboard level data is required as well as page level data.
4) Can be automatically updated.


Do you have any better solutions/suggestions? Thanks!
